The Variegated Flycatcher (Empidonomus varius) is a bird species in the family Tyrannidae (tyrannen), within the order Passeriformes (sperlingsvögel). Recorded measurements include a wingspan of 19.4 cm and a weight of 26.1 g. The IUCN Red List classifies it as Least Concern.
